About The Salvation Army Owosso Citadel Corps

The Salvation Army is a globally recognized charitable organization with a long-standing commitment to serving those less fortunate. The Owosso Citadel Corps represents a specific local unit within this larger network, operating under the guidance of the Central USA Territory. Its primary function is to address various social issues, including poverty, homelessness, addiction, and family hardship. The Corps operates as a hub for spiritual guidance, practical assistance, and community engagement.

Key Services and Programs

The Owosso Citadel Corps offers a comprehensive suite of services designed to meet the multifaceted needs of its community. These services frequently encompass:

  • Church Services: Regular worship services provide a space for spiritual reflection and fellowship, fostering a sense of community and connection.
  • Thrift Store Operations: A prominent feature of the Corps is its thrift store, offering affordable clothing, household goods, and other items. The store’s operation is integral to funding many of their programs and providing resources to those in need. It’s known for its extensive selection and remarkably low prices, as evidenced by numerous positive visitor experiences.
  • Social Services: The Corps provides direct assistance to individuals and families facing financial difficulties, offering support with rent, utilities, and other essential needs.
  • Addiction Recovery Programs: Recognizing the prevalence of addiction, the Owosso Citadel Corps offers support groups and resources for individuals seeking recovery.
  • Youth Programs: Activities and programs are designed to engage and support young people, providing a safe and positive environment.
  • Community Outreach: The Corps actively participates in community events and initiatives, striving to build relationships and address local challenges.
